定理 分布式linux cap
Linux 文件系统结构和组织
Linux 的文件系统结构和组织采用了层次化的树状结构,以下是对其进行详细说明并举例: 根目录(/):根目录是整个文件系统的最顶层目录,所有其他目录和文件都位于根目录下。 系统目录: /bin:存放系统所需的基本命令(二进制文件),如 ls、cp、rm 等。例如,/bin/ls 是用于列出目录内容的 ......
Linux命令
### Linux常用命令介绍 *注:*自学笔记,如有错误请见谅 | 目录名称 | 应放置文件的内容 | | | | | /boot | 开机所需文件—内核、开机菜单以及所需配置文件等 | | /dev | 以文件形式存放任何设备与接口 | | /etc | 配置文件 | | /home | 用户主 ......
Linux 基础操作
登录和退出 Linux 系统: 登录系统:使用用户名和密码登录到 Linux 系统,例如通过 SSH(Secure Shell)远程登录。 退出系统:使用 exit 命令或者快捷键 Ctrl + D 退出当前登录会话。 文件和目录管理: 查看目录内容:使用 ls 命令列出当前目录下的文件和子目录。 ......
Rocky Linux 9 Minio 单机 Docker 部署
1、Docker CE安装 参考:https://www.cnblogs.com/a120608yby/p/9883175.html 2、Docker Compose安装 参考:https://www.cnblogs.com/a120608yby/p/14582853.html 3、Minio部署 ......
linux----使用rm -rf 删除大文件后磁盘空间并未释放的解决办法
https://blog.csdn.net/redrose2100/article/details/129573059 【原文链接】linux 使用rm -rf 删除大文件后磁盘空间并未释放的解决办法 (1)问题:当发现linux系统中存在大文件,磁盘空间快满了后,一般会使用rm -rf xxx 将 ......
linux 中根据指定列 删除重复行
001、 [root@PC1 test02]# ls a.txt [root@PC1 test02]# cat a.txt ## 测试数据 ID=gene-ABCC1 a 6121 ID=gene-ABCC1 b 6121 ID=gene-JFEE3 j 876 ID=gene-ABCC5 c 57 ......
Linux 系统日常运维 9 大技能,搞定 90% 日常运维
一、Linux 系统日常运维九大技能 1、安装部署 方式:U盘,光盘和网络安装 其中网络安装已经成为了目前批量部署的首选方式:主要工具有Cobbler和PXE+kickstart 可以参考如下链接内容: http://www.cnblogs.com/mchina/p/centos-pxe-kicks ......
linux 命令
chmod [option] mode file # 将文件file的权限修改为mode # option可以为-r 表示递归修改文件 chown [option] owner:gourp file # 修改文件file的所有者和组 sed -i 's/aaa/bbb/g' filename # 将 ......
记一次.Net分布式事务死锁现象以及解决方法
在本文中,将介绍一次遇到的.Net分布式事务死锁现象以及解决方法。我们将首先了解事务框架的构成,然后分析导致死锁的代码,最后提出解决方法。 # 事务框架 本次开发框架JMSFramework将分布式事务划分为4个阶段,分别是:执行、确认、提交和重试。 1、执行 调用微服务来执行相关的业务操作。如果其 ......
linux安装node
**1. 下载node** 去[nodejs官网](https://nodejs.org/en/download)下载最新版本 ![](https://img2023.cnblogs.com/blog/3235502/202307/3235502-20230706093853927-17816739 ......
Linux 错误: $'\r': command not found --九五小庞
前段时间写脚本出现了$'\r': command not found问题 其实log报错已经非常明确了,是linux无法解析$'\r'。这其实是windows与linux系统的差异导致的。 因为linux上的换行符为\n,而windows上的换行符为\r\n。所以脚本到linux上就无法解析了。 通 ......
读发布!设计与部署稳定的分布式系统(第2版)笔记20_实例层之代码
![](https://img2023.cnblogs.com/blog/3076680/202307/3076680-20230704144741811-1382373830.png) # 1. 术语的定义 ## 1.1. 服务 ### 1.1.1. 指共同协作、以单元的形式对外提供功能的跨机器进 ......
Linux调优–I/O 调度器
Linux 的 I/O 调度器是一个以块式 I/O 访问存储卷的进程,有时也叫磁盘调度器。Linux I/O 调度器的工作机制是控制块设备的请求队列:确定队列中哪些 I/O 的优先级更高以及何时下发 I/O 到块设备,以此来减少磁盘寻道时间,从而提高系统的吞吐量。 i/o调度器是什么? Linux ......
Linux调优–I/O 调度器
Linux 的 I/O 调度器是一个以块式 I/O 访问存储卷的进程,有时也叫磁盘调度器。Linux I/O 调度器的工作机制是控制块设备的请求队列:确定队列中哪些 I/O 的优先级更高以及何时下发 I/O 到块设备,以此来减少磁盘寻道时间,从而提高系统的吞吐量。 i/o调度器是什么? Linux ......
Linux调优–I/O 调度器
Linux 的 I/O 调度器是一个以块式 I/O 访问存储卷的进程,有时也叫磁盘调度器。Linux I/O 调度器的工作机制是控制块设备的请求队列:确定队列中哪些 I/O 的优先级更高以及何时下发 I/O 到块设备,以此来减少磁盘寻道时间,从而提高系统的吞吐量。 i/o调度器是什么? Linux ......
淘宝技术三面题目:分布式架构+红黑树+SpringMVC+设计模式
淘宝一面 Java容器有哪些?哪些是同步容器,哪些是并发容器? ArrayList和LinkedList的插入和访问的时间复杂度? java反射原理, 注解原理? 新生代分为几个区?使用什么算法进行垃圾回收?为什么使用这个算法? HashMap在什么情况下会扩容,或者有哪些操作会导致扩容? Hash ......
HDU6608 Fansblog(威尔逊定理+Miller_Rabin素数判定+快速幂+龟速乘+求逆)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=6608 题目大意: 给定一个素数p,找到比p小的最大素数q,计算q! mod p 解题思路: 这道题有三种方法 第一种(最快): 先用Miller_Rabin测试找到q,根据威尔逊定理,(p-1)! mo ......
linux 中 sed命令的 -s选项
001、-s用于指定输出的间隔符 [root@PC1 test02]# seq 10 ## 默认输出分隔符为换行符 1 2 3 4 5 6 7 8 9 10 [root@PC1 test02]# seq -s " " 10 ## 指定空格为换行符 1 2 3 4 5 6 7 8 9 10 [root ......
威尔逊定理
威尔逊定理:若p为素数,则p可以整除(p-1)!+1 例题1:hdu5391 直接套用威尔逊定理,注意n=4的结果是2 代码: #include<bits/stdc++.h> #define ll long long using namespace std; const int N = 1e9+39 ......
27.Linux命令大全
1.基本命令 uname -m 显示机器的处理器架构 uname -r 显示正在使用的内核版本 dmidecode -q 显示硬件系统部件 (SMBIOS / DMI) hdparm -i /dev/hda 罗列一个磁盘的架构特性 hdparm -tT /dev/sda 在磁盘上执行测试性读取操作系 ......
不同服务器(Linux)的环境(anaconda)迁移
# 1. 将服务器A的环境迁移到服务器B中 使用命令scp 首先,连接你当前的服务器 ```bash ssh 用户名@服务器ip地址 ``` 然后输入你当前需要转移的环境目录 ```bash scp -vrC A服务器文件名 用户名@B服务器ip地址:文件名 ``` ```bash scp -vrC ......
linux 怎么定时去执行一个 .sh 文件
在 Linux 中,你可以使用 crontab 来定时执行一个 .sh 文件。Crontab 是一个定时任务管理工具,它允许你在指定的时间间隔内运行命令或脚本。 下面是一些使用 crontab 定时执行 .sh 文件的步骤: - 打开终端或 SSH 连接到你的 Linux 服务器。 输入以下命令以编 ......
linux学习笔记
linux学习笔记 一、静态库与动态库的制作 1.1 静态库 1.1.1 静态库编译时与主程序一起编译 1.1.2 g++ -c -o xxx.a xxx.cpp就可以制作一个静态库 1.1.3 g++ -o xxx xxx.cpp xxx.a(或者用-L指定库目录 -l指定库名称)可以把静态库和主 ......
RV1126 Linux 以太网MAC PHY 芯片8201f gmac dts配置
RK 系列的 SoC 中内置了以太网 MAC 控制器,所以只需要搭配一颗以太网 PHY芯片, 即可实现以太网卡功能。 按照规范, 即使是不同厂家的 PHY,同样有一部分寄存器的定义是通用的, 只要配置了这些通用的寄存器, 基本上 PHY 就可以正常工作。在 Linux 驱动中有通用的 PHY 驱动, ......
Linux系统编程 C/C++ 以及Qt 中的零拷贝技术: 从底层原理到高级应用
https://blog.csdn.net/qq_21438461/article/details/130764349 Linux系统编程 C/C++ 以及Qt 中的零拷贝技术: 从底层原理到高级应用一、零拷贝技术的概念与价值 (Zero-Copy Concept and Value)1.1 什么是 ......
Linux下实现Web数据同步的四种方式
实现web数据同步的四种方式 1、nfs实现web数据共享 2、rsync +inotify实现web数据同步 3、rsync+sersync更快更节约资源实现web数据同步 4、unison+inotify实现web数据双向同步 一、nfs实现web数据共享 nfs能实现数据同步是通过NAS(网络 ......
Linux自签证书
## 创建证书临时存放目录 ```shell mkdir -p /tmp/cert cd /tmp/cert ``` ## 创建自签证书的脚本 > create-cert.sh 内容如下: ```shell #!/bin/bash -e help () { echo ' ' echo ' --ssl ......
linux 中 数组的常见操作
001、创建数组 [root@PC1 test02]# ay=(1 2 3 4) ## 生成数组 [root@PC1 test02]# echo ${ay[*]} ## 输出数组 1 2 3 4 [root@PC1 test02]# echo ${#ay[*]} ## 输出数组的长度 4 002、 ......
JAVA微服务分布式事务的几种实现方式
# 基础理论 ## CAP理论 一致性(Consistency) :在分布式系统中所有的数据备份,在同一时刻都保持一致状态,如无法保证状态一致,直接返回错误; 可用性(Availability):在集群中一部分节点故障,也能保证客户端访问系统并得到正确响应,允许一定时间内数据状态不一致; 分区容错性 ......